[ critics ] round 4 begins with a campy start as dueling hosts Steve Weiss + Philip Bloom critique two future world music videos and quickly move onto an Urban Nature film. Next, a skilled shooter + extreme skier with a Canon 5DMKII creates, “Some of the best skiing footage I’ve ever seen.” The best part, Steve gets a beginning, a middle, and a happy ending. [ critics ] offering an eclectic mix of personalities, perspectives and laughter.

About [ critics ]: Film/video veterans, Steve Weiss, Director of FilmFellas/Critics, and Philip Bloom, a London based Independent DP and Director (philipbloom.co.uk/) come together as dueling co-hosts to candidly critique web based video content.
